Job Description

  • Evaluating patients’ medical histories to ensure the various medical imaging procedures will not harm them
  • Suggesting alternative medical imaging techniques, when necessary
  • Informing patients about the medical imaging process
  • Using devices such as computer tomography (CT) scanners and mag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) machines
  • Performing or directing radiology staff to carry out image-guided, diagnostic procedures
  • Working with radiology lab technicians to perfect image quality
  • Interpreting the results from diagnostic imaging procedures to determine diagnoses
  • Communicating and discussing results and diagnoses with physicians
  • Compiling written reports of results and diagnoses
  • Following medical protocols for resuscitation, bleeding, infection, or other emergency situations, when necessary
